Live music and great atmosphere, fancier place but plenty of people were wearing jeans, and the bar was definitely popular. For an appetizer we got the feta spinach wontons, and those alone make me want to go back. They were delicious. For entree's we got the baked Campanelle and the ribeye. The Campanelle was essentially a "grown up" macaroni and cheese, but who doesn't love that. It was the only vegetarian friendly entree on the menu besides the salads, and was my order by default. The server did not mention that the dish it came in is what it was cooked in, and I did burn myself. The ribeye was tender and juicy, but we wished the portion of the sides that came with were larger. The vegetable of the day was green beans, they were fresh and crisp. The soup of the day was chicken gumbo, and we loved the large pieces of chicken in it. It was very nicely seasoned. Our server was not as attentive as we had hoped, although it was not that busy tonight. We were out of water for the majority of the night, which was really needed after my basil lemon drop that was all basil and no lemon. Overall, the food will have us coming again, but maybe not regulars. Especially for the lack of service compared to the price point.
